IIC's Final Oil-for-Food Report to Be Issued on October 27, 2005
1st Nov 2005, 17:27 GMT
On October 27, 2005, the Independent Inquiry Committee (IIC) into the United Nations Oil-for-Food Program will issue its final report on the role of private companies and individuals involved in the program.
